Where the Willows Weep: Horror in the Deep South

It’s hot and humid, the cicadas are buzzing, and there’s violence in the air.

Horror books and short stories set in the Deep South.

Think: swamps, bayous, bullfrogs, Spanish moss, hauntings, haints, voodoo/hoodoo, monsters hidden in plain sight, structural violence, and the oppressive weight of history.

Comps: True Detective S1; Sinners; South of Midnight
